Description
The AN/APQ-170 is a multimode, redundant, dual-band (X-band and Ku-band), forward-looking airborne radar system. Developed specifically for the U.S. Air Force's Lockheed MC-130H Combat Talon II aircraft, it integrates terrain-following and terrain-avoidance features, ground-mapping, weather detection and avoidance, and beacon interrogation modes. The radar has an instrumented range of 50 nautical miles (approximately 92 km) and features two reflector antennas for its different frequency bands, housed under a distinctive nose radome.
